Sentence Pattern
A group of words, which gives complete
sense is called a sentence.
 NOUN is a word used as the name of a person,
place, thing and animal.
Eg. Person- Amy, Place- Chennai,
Thing- Computer, Animal- Dog
 PRONOUN is a word used instead of a noun
Eg. I, We, You, He, She, It, They….
PARTS OF SPEECH
 VERB is a word used to express an action or states.
Eg. Come, read, speak, write, learn, am, is, was, etc.
 ADVERB is a word that describes or modifies a verb,
an adjective or another adverb.
Eg. Very, cleverly, quickly, never, often, etc.
The baby cried loudly
PARTS OF SPEECH
 ABJECTIVE is a word that describes or modifies a noun.
Eg. Clever, beautiful, honest, some, great, etc.
 PREPOSITION is a word placed before with noun or a pronoun
to show the relation of the noun or pronoun to something else.
Eg. In, of, at,on, by, for, from, out, to, etc.
PARTS OF SPEECH
 CONJUCTION is a word used to join words or sentences.
Eg: and, but, because, or, so, still, if, as, etc.
She got good marks because she studied
hard.
 INTERJECTION is a word which expresses some sudden
feeling.
Eg. Wow, oh, hello, ah, bravo, etc.
PARTS OF SPEECH
 PROPER NOUN is the name of the particular person or
place.
Eg: Hari, Akbar, Stephen, etc.
 COMMON NOUN is a name given in common to every
person or thing of the same class or kind.
Eg: boy, girl, woman, tree, animal, school, student, teacher,
etc.
 COLLECTIVE NOUN is the name of a number of
persons or things taken together.
Eg: Police, army, crowd, family, etc.
TYPES OF NOUNS
 ABSTRACT NOUN is usually the name of a quality,
action or state.
Eg: Quality – kindness, honesty; Action – laughter, hatred;
state – youth.
 MATERIAL NOUN is the name of a raw material of a
product.
Eg: gold, silver, fiber, diamond, wood, day, cotton.
TYPES OF NOUNS
 Subject (S)
 Verb (V)
 Object (O)
 Direct Object (DO)
 Indirect Object (IO)
 Complement (C)
 Adjunct (A)
BASIC PARTS OF A SENTENCE
 SV - Child laughs.
 SVO - I play hockey.
 SVC - He is smart.
 SVOC - I painted the car blue.
 SVIODO - My father presented me a watch.
 SVDOIO - She gave money to the poor.
The basic Sentence patterns are given
below:
To get ‘Subject’ ask the question
‘Who?’ before the verb.
It consists of Nouns or pronouns
and occurs before a verb.
SUBJECT (S)
Example:
Nancy danced well. Who danced
well? (Here “Nancy” answers for the
who?)
The child broke the glass. (Here “The
child” answers the question who?)
SUBJECT (S)
A verb shows an action or activity or
work done by the subject. It also tells
the status.
To get ‘verb’ ask what does the subject
do?
VERB (V)
Example:
Jems wrote a letter. What did Jems
do? (Here wrote answers the
question)
He is a doctor.
The baby is crying.
VERB (V)
To get the Object, ask the question
‘What?’ or ‘Whom?’.
‘What’ is for things and ‘Whom’ is for
persons. Persons may be nouns or
pronouns.
OBJECT (O)
Example:
 He bought a pen. He handles the
computer. I saw him.
 She ate cake.
 I fried the eggs.
 Raj played cricket.
OBJECT (O)
Direct object answers the question
‘what’.
Example:
I like animals.
DIRECT OBJECT (DO)
Indirect object answers the
question ‘whom’?
Example:
I gave Rosy a pen.
INDIRECT OBJECT (IO)
The words, required to complete the meaning
of a sentence are Called Complement.
Example:
 He is a dentist.
 You look beautiful.
 It grew dark.
COMPLEMENT (C)
Object complement answers for the questions
“How” asked on the object.
Example:
 He painted the car blue. How did
he painted the car? Here the word blue
answers for the question “How” asked
on the object car.
 We call Kamarajar Karmaveerar.
 They selected her leader.
COMPLEMENT (C)
To get ‘Adjunct’ ask the question where ,how,
when or why.
Example:
 My father is a farmer in thiruvarur.
Where? (Place), How? (Manner), When? (Time),
Why? (Reason). Here, there by bus / cycle now,
later due to cold
ADJUNCT(A)
Example:
 They ate heartily.
 We left at noon.
 We left the house early.
 She ate the steak almost raw.
ADJUNCT(A)
